We're seeking a Data Scientist with a marketing background who will be a member of our analytics team and help with needs across all our clients.

This person will lead the creation of various advanced marketing models. They will also be responsible for applying advanced analytics methods and algorithms for identifying trends and solutions for our clients.

Key Responsibilities :

  • Analyze clickstream data on eCommerce website to optimize conversion rates
  • Work closely with various teams by providing data visualization around business and functional performance.
  • Ensure up-to-date dashboard information highlighting critical areas for decision making.
  • Provide training to users on the use of the dashboards.
  • Provide monthly / quarterly reports on KPI's using various software (Excel, Power BI, SQL, R, Python, etc.).
  • Automate data gathering and curation of all data sources
  • Perform other duties and projects as assigned, related to data analytics
  • Lead technical development of cutting-edge analytics and decision support tools
  • Able to partner with various teams and help with storytelling to clients
  • Work with datasets and develop solutions (i.e., methodology and algorithms) for problems.
  • Solve non-routine, inter-disciplinary analysis problems by applying analytical methods as needed.

Requirements :

  • MS or higher degree in Industrial Engineering, Chemical Engineering, Computer Science, Statistics or Operations Research with a specialization in data science or analytics
  • 3-5+ years of relevant industry experience
  • Strong programming skills in Python or at least one major programming language
  • Demonstrated ability to follow software development best practices
  • Experience with data visualization
  • Very good knowledge of MS Office
  • Strong analytical and problem-solving skills
